Overview

PCP investments are based on strong partnerships with management and owners and the implementation of the best corporate governance standards. Together they define strategy, implement long-term financing structure and recruit executive talent. Their investment and operating team builds direct relationships with portfolio companies, offering hands-on operational support and deep sector expertise leveraging a global expert network to achieve sustainable growth.

Their investment philosophy is to be the partner of choice for business owners and management teams. They provide tailormade strategic guidelines, expansion capital, support in M&A processes, operational improvements and implementation of industry best practices.

Investment criteria

  • Sectors: Healthcare, Technology, Consumer, Business Services.
  • Geographies: South Eastern Europe.
  • Average investment: €10 - 25M.

 

Portfolio: Vetti Group, Arsano Medical Group, Keindl, Adria Dental Group.
